GB28181平台安装部署过程 - 可接入海康、大华、华为、科达、宇视等等设备和平台
好文章,来自【福优学苑@音视频+流媒体】
本文章向大家介绍GB28181平台安装部署过程 - 可接入海康、大华、华为、科达、宇视等等设备和平台,主要包括GB28181平台安装部署过程 - 可接入海康、大华、华为、科达、宇视等等设备和平台使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。
准备环境
准备一台windows 2008 R2(或者win7)及以上的64位windows操作系统,或者Linux 64位操作系统,最低配置要求:
CPU: 双核;
内存:4GB;
存储:128GB
网口:千兆网口;
首先,下载LiveGBS安装包;
下载完成后,解压 LiveGBS 文件夹下的所有压缩包,解压到当前文件夹即可,
软件服务配置
LiveCMS信令服务
LiveCMS默认占用5060、10000、26379,其中5060 TCP、UDP都需要开放,其他为TCP
Windows可以双击LiveCMS.exe 前台启动,或者双击ServiceInstall-LiveCMS.exe自动安装成Windows服务。
如果这几个端口被其他程序占用了,可以在livecms.ini配置文件中修改端口。修改后需要重启LiveCMS;
如果是双击LiveCMS.exe 前台启动的LiveCMS,停止需要用Ctrl + C来停止。如果是ServiceInstall-LiveCMS.exe启动的,需要执行ServiceUninstall-LiveCMS.exe卸载服务。Linux版本启动是start.sh, 停止是stop.sh
启动后,浏览器访问服务器ip:10000端口,登录LiveCMS,默认用户名、密码都是admin 。在基础配置页面展示了本服务的配置信息,也可以在页面上修改。
LiveSMS流媒体服务
端口占用:
TCP 端口 : 5070(SIP), 10001(HTTP), 11935(RTMP Live), 30000-40000(RTP over TCP)
UDP 端口 : 5070(SIP), 50000-60000(RTP/RTCP over UDP)
Windows可以双击LiveSMS.exe 前台启动,或者双击ServiceInstall-LiveSMS.exe自动安装成Windows服务。Linux执行start.sh启动。
启动后浏览器打开服务器ip:10001, 默认admin/admin登录。基础配置页面可修改自己的IP地址。
GB28181设备/平台接入
在下级平台中配置接入服务:
接入服务IP: LiveCMS的IP
接入服务端口:LiveCMS页面基础配置里的端口,默认5060
realm: 3402000000
编码ID: 34020000001110000005(这是个示例,具体根据下级域的域编码或者具体接入平台规则而定)
用户名:配置和编码ID一致,如果下级平台不允许这么设置,则可自行酌情设置.
密码:LiveCMS页面基础配置里的端口,默认12345678
详情
信令服务
LiveCMS
SIP 中心信令服务, 单节点, 自带一个 Redis Server, 随 LiveCMS 自启动, 不需要手动运行
LiveCMS 端口使用
TCP 端口 : 15060(SIP 和设备通信), 10000(HTTP), 26379(Redis Server, 不建议对外开放)
UDP 端口 : 15060(SIP 和设备通信)
流媒体服务
LiveSMS
SIP 流媒体服务, 根据需要可部署多套
LiveSMS 端口使用
TCP 端口 : 15070(SIP 和 LiveCMS 通信), 10001(HTTP), 11935(RTMP Live), 30000-30500(RTP over TCP)
UDP 端口 : 15070(SIP 和 LiveCMS 通信), 30000-30500(RTP/RTCP over UDP)
配置信令服务(LiveCMS)
服务名称:LiveCMS
配置文件:livecms.ini
所在位置:LiveCMS-windows-***.zip, LiveCMS-linux-***.tar.gz
WEB管理:LiveGBS->基础配置->信令服务配置
[sip] -> host
SIP 中心信令服务器 IP
[sip] -> serial
SIP 中心信令服务器 ID
[sip] -> realm
SIP 中心信令服务器 Realm
[sip] -> device_password
设备接入统一密码
配置流媒体服务(LiveSMS)
服务名称:LiveSMS
配置文件:livesms.ini
所在位置:LiveSMS-windows-***.zip, LiveSMS-linux-***.tar.gz
WEB管理:LiveGBS->基础配置->流媒体服务配置
[sip] -> host
SIP 流媒体服务器 IP
[sip] -> serial
SIP 流媒体服务器 ID
[sip] -> realm
SIP 流媒体服务器 Realm
[sip] -> wan_ip (可选配置)
SIP 流媒体服务器公网 IP
[sip] -> use_wan_ip_recv_stream (可选配置)
可选配置0/1, 指示流媒体服务器使用公网 IP 接收国标下级流数据
[rtp] -> udp_port_range
RTP over UDP 端口区间
[rtp] -> tcp_port_range
RTP over TCP 端口区间
服务运行
注意
安装包所在路径不能包含 中文
运行成功后,访问 LiveGBS WEB 管理页面
WEB后台管理(默认端口10000),浏览器地址栏输入 http://ip:10000 访问 如:http://127.0.0.1:10000
开启了HTTPS后,浏览器地址栏输入 https://ip:port 访问
Windows
方式一:直接运行
信令服务(LiveCMS)
启动: 解压目录中,直接双击 LiveCMS.exe,服务会以图标方式展示在任务栏上,可以右击服务图标,点击 打开 WEB后台管理
停止:右击任务栏上服务图标,点击 退出 服务运行
流媒体服务(LiveSMS)
启动: 解压目录中,直接双击 LiveSMS.exe,服务会以图标方式展示在任务栏上
停止:右击任务栏上服务图标,点击 退出 服务运行
方式二:以服务启动
信令服务(LiveCMS)
安装: 解压目录中,直接双击 ServiceInstall-LiveCMS.exe
卸载: 以 ServiceUninstall-LiveCMS.exe 卸载 CMS 服务
流媒体服务(LiveSMS)
安装: 解压目录中,直接双击 ServiceInstall-LiveSMS.exe
卸载: 以 ServiceUninstall-LiveSMS.exe 卸载 SMS 服务
Linux
方式一:直接运行
信令服务(LiveCMS)
cd LiveCMS
./livecms
#停止: Ctrl + C
流媒体服务(LiveSMS)
cd LiveSMS
./livesms
#停止:Ctrl + C
方式二:以服务启动
信令服务(LiveCMS)
cd LiveCMS
./start.sh
#停止: ./stop.sh
流媒体服务(LiveSMS)
cd LiveSMS
./start.sh
#停止: ./stop.sh
配置设备接入
好文章,来自【福优学苑@音视频+流媒体】
***【在线视频教程】***